A cartographic representation illustrating the geographic line separating the principal drainage basins of North America, located within a specific state in the Rocky Mountains, provides critical information for various applications. Such a resource delineates the area where precipitation flows either towards the Pacific Ocean or towards the Atlantic and Arctic Oceans and the Gulf of Mexico. These depictions commonly show elevations, landmarks, and surrounding geographical features of the terrain.

The delineation serves as a valuable tool for activities such as hiking, backpacking, and outdoor recreation, allowing individuals to understand watershed boundaries and plan routes accordingly. Furthermore, its historical significance lies in its influence on exploration, settlement patterns, and resource management across the region. Understanding its location is crucial for effective water resource allocation and conservation efforts, impacting agriculture, municipal water supplies, and ecosystem health.

A visual representation depicting the geographical boundary separating the drainage basins of the eastern portion of a continent, directing water flow to either the Atlantic Ocean or the Gulf of Mexico, is a valuable resource. Such a cartographic tool illustrates the ridgeline that dictates the course of rivers and streams across the landscape. As an example, a detailed depiction showcases the high-elevation areas spanning from the Appalachian Mountains down through Florida, indicating the precise watershed divide.

This depiction possesses significant value for various disciplines. Hydrologists utilize it to understand water flow patterns and predict flood risks. Conservationists employ it to manage ecosystems and protect water resources. Historians find it relevant in understanding settlement patterns and the development of transportation routes. Understanding this watershed boundary is also crucial for resource management, infrastructure planning, and comprehending regional ecological connectivity.

A cartographic representation illustrating the line of summits across the state delineating the principal, albeit not invariably the highest, ridgeline separating the major drainage basins of North America within its boundaries. This depiction is typically presented through topographic maps, often enhanced with color-coding or shading to emphasize elevation changes and the precise location of the drainage divide. An example would be a publicly accessible United States Geological Survey (USGS) map highlighting this feature and its relationship to key geographical landmarks such as mountain peaks, rivers, and national forests.

The demarcation holds significant importance for understanding water resource management, ecological distribution, and regional climate patterns. Its historical context is rooted in the exploration and surveying of the American West, playing a crucial role in defining jurisdictional boundaries and facilitating resource allocation. Awareness of this geographical feature aids in infrastructure planning, risk assessment related to natural hazards, and appreciation of the state’s diverse ecosystems.
